6. Kraken
Kraken is one of the first and most secure exchanges in the world and was established in 2011. It has over 425 cryptocurrencies and fiat trading pairs. Thai users are supported on Kraken. It holds licenses in Ireland, Canada, Australia, and Bermuda, providing strong regulatory reach which is why Kraken doesn’t have an office in Thailand. Thai users are allowed to use the global trading services Kraken offers.

Kraken has trading fees of 0.16% for makers, and 0.26% for takers, and high volume users are given discounts. It allows for staking, margin trading, and proof of reserve audits. Users requiring high security, transparency, and reliability will find Kraken to their liking. Thai users will also have no problem with Kraken as they operate in over 190 countries.

8. Zengo
Zengo, launched in 2018, is a self custodian crypto wallet with an in-built exchange feature. It is also not a conventional exchange, but lets users from Thailand buy, sell and swap cryptocurrencies and NFT’s of over 1,000 varieties.
Zengo’s main selling point is its elimination of vulnerable seed phrases with the use of 3D FaceLock and MPC security. It holds Bitcoin and Ethereum and multi-chain assets like Polygon.

No KYC is required. Users can hold and manage several distinct wallets for varying purposes. Secure, mobile-first crypto access is why Zengo is rated 4.78 stars on app stores. Zengo is a self custodian exchange which offers real time risk alerts, trading fees set by provider and inheritance style asset continuity. Zengo is still ideal for users from Thailand who want a privacy-first exchange.
